Anti-Telangana politician Jagan Mohan Reddy today courted arrest as he marched towards Parliament to protest against the creation of the new state by dividing Andhra Pradesh.

The protest by Jagan and nearly his 4,000 supporters in Delhi comes ahead of the Telangana Bill that will be up for discussion in Parliament on Tuesday.

Earlier in the day, hinting at Congress Vice President Rahul Gandhi, Jagan said that the Congress was taking the decision to divide the state just to make one person the Prime Minister. He also stuck to his stand that he will support any party which is for a united Andhra.

Jagan also met senior BJP leaders and said that his party would support any party that keeps Andhra united. “That is my agenda. We have tried to prevail on the BJP. If the state is divided we are doomed. Jagan alone is nothing, I need the support of everyone. Congress has 200 plus, BJP has 100 plus MPs,” he said.

The Telangana bill will be taken up in Parliament tomorrow and the government is determined to get it passed, even in the middle of protests if it can’t be discussed, sources have told to media. 

The resolve, on a day the BJP warned against passing the proposal without a proper discussion, is likely to escalate the political row over Telangana.
